Andy Foster, an accomplished kitchen and bath designer, has been a cabinetmaker for more than 40 years. He began woodworking as a hobby shortly after graduating from Ithaca College, and it soon became a passion and a profession. In 1987, after over a decade of commercial woodworking in several venues, he founded Foster Custom Kitchens. Ten years later, he bought the Queen Anne style house that is our one of a kind, charming showroom. What stands out about Andy is his knowledge of and experience in all phases of project development: design, fabrication, installation, giving him a unique perspective of the process involved in creating a new or remodeled space.
